Guatemala. With the construction of 11 new suites and 3 executive rooms, the Radisson Hotel & Suites Guatemala City completed the first phase of its remodeling and expansion project.
The second phase of the project, which will end this year, will include the construction of another 9 suites, the complete remodeling of the lobby and the event rooms. The investment of this first stage was 400 thousand dollars and a new investment of 350 thousand dollars is projected for the second phase.
The new suites are equipped with water-saving showers, 39" TVs, vinyl flooring for high traffic and greater hygiene, high-speed Wi-Fi and greater acoustic comfort, among other amenities.
Paola García, marketing manager of Grupo Azur, said that "this evolution will give us the possibility to grow in the corporate segment, in addition to allowing us to offer more rooms and better services to guests during their business trips. But there is still room to continue growing and enhancing our service offering. That's why we resolved to strengthen and expand our facilities."
